What is the Specified Hazard Insurance Policy Application?

The Specified Hazard Insurance Policy Application is a crucial document used to obtain insurance coverage specifically tailored for amateur theater activities. This insurance coverage is essential to protect organizations and participants involved in theater productions from unforeseen hazards. The application includes significant details such as the name of the plan sponsor and the specific activities that will be covered under the policy.
By ensuring that organizations have appropriate insurance coverage, they safeguard themselves against potential liabilities and provide peace of mind to all participants.

Who Needs to Fill Out the Specified Hazard Insurance Policy Application?

Organizations sponsoring amateur theater activities are the primary audience for this application. Additionally, agents who assist with the application process play a crucial role in ensuring that the submission is accurate and complete. Both the applicant and agent must sign the application to validate it, underscoring the importance of their respective roles.
